                            Hall of fame tribute match
                            Saturday, May 10
                            MCG @ 7.40pm

                            VICTORIA
                            B: Campbell Brown, 32, Matthew Scarlett, 30, Darren Milburn, 39
                            HB: Heath Shaw, 22, Trent Croad, 24, Jarrad Waite, 31
                            C: Brent Harvey, 29, Sam Mitchell, 7, Adam Goodes, 37
                            HF: Ryan O?Keefe, 1, Jonathan Brown, 16, Robert Murphy, 2
                            F: Steve Johnson, 20, Brendan Fevola, 23, Daniel Bradshaw, 36
                            Foll: Troy Simmonds, 5, Jimmy Bartel, 3, Chris Judd, 4
                            Int: Josh Fraser, 25, Luke Power, 8, Paul Chapman, 35, James Kelly, 9, Nathan Foley, 41, Scott Pendlebury, 10, Joel Selwood, 14
                            Emergencies, Jarryd Roughead, 18, Brad Sewell, 12

                            DREAM TEAM
                            B: Graham Johncock 2, Ben Rutten, 25, Craig Bolton, 6
                            HB: Andrew McLeod, 23, Matthew Pavlich, 29, Adam Cooney, 5
                            C: Matthew Richardson, 12, Daniel Kerr, 4, Shaun Burgoyne, 14
                            HF: Simon Goodwin, 36, Cameron Mooney, 21, Daniel Motlop, 22
                            F: Brett Burton, 24, Lance Franklin, 23, Leon Davis, 1
                            Foll: Dean Cox, 20, Peter Burgoyne, 7, Kane Cornes, 18
                            Int: Nathan Bock, 15, Jamie Charman, 19, Joel Corey, 11, Matthew Stokes, 27, Brett Kirk, 31, Ryan Griffen, 16, Darren Glass, 10
                            Emg: Nathan Bassett, 8, Daniel Cross, 13, Corey Enright, 44
